AMATEUR RADIO IN THE CLASSROOM

• Teaches basic electronics and radio wave theory

• Allows exploration of new technologies

• Promotes improvement of communication skills

• Promotes global communication and understanding

• Grown to include new operating modes besides Morse code and voice, including digital and TV

AMATEUR RADIO IN THE CLASSROOM • An entry level amateur license (Technician) is easy to get

• 35 question test from publicly published question pool

• No Morse code (CW) requirement for any license

MODES

• Most common modes have been Morse code (CW), voice, radioteletype (RTTY) and packet

• In recent years have added amateur television (ATV) and computer operated modes using sound cards like PSK32, JT65 and JT9 which use less bandwidth than CW

• Now have digital voice modes like Icom D-STAR and Yaesu Fusion that can also link via Internet (trunking)

MODES

• In the last year there has been an upswing in digital mobile radio (DMR) which allows voice and data to share bandwidth on a repeater frequency

• We are seeing many amateur radio accessory projects that utilize Arduino which also teaches programming skills in addition to electronics fundamentals and circuit design

JT65 AND JT9

• JT65 and JT9 are two new computer sound card HF (shortwave), low power radio communication modes that use less bandwidth then their predecessor PSK31 mode

• JT65 uses free, open source software and is limited to 13 characters on each transmission using 65 tones. JT9 uses 9

DIGITAL MOBILE RADIO (DMR)

• Requires special DMR radios and repeaters

• Most systems use standard Motorola MOTOTRBO protocol

• Uses two slot TDMA (Time Division Multiple Access) in 12.5 kHz channels

MORE DIGITAL OPERATING MODES

• Packet radio

• Automatic Packet Reporting System (APRS) can be used for geocaching, GIS mapping or foxhunting projects which use directional antennas to monitor signal strength to find hidden transmitters

• RTTY and PSK31
